首页
/ 4步掌握H5-Dooring:面向设计与开发人员的低代码可视化工具

4步掌握H5-Dooring:面向设计与开发人员的低代码可视化工具

2026-03-11 02:53:59作者:宣海椒Queenly

低代码(无需手动编写大量代码的开发模式)技术正在改变传统H5页面的创建方式。如何在不牺牲专业性的前提下,让设计和开发人员快速制作出高质量的交互式H5页面?H5-Dooring作为一款开源的H5可视化编辑器,通过直观的拖拽操作和丰富的组件库,为这一问题提供了高效解决方案。本文将从价值定位、核心能力、实战路径和场景拓展四个维度,全面解析这款工具如何满足从个人创作者到企业团队的多样化需求。

价值定位:为什么H5-Dooring能重新定义H5制作流程?

在数字化营销和企业展示需求日益增长的今天,H5页面作为信息传递的重要载体,其制作效率与质量直接影响业务效果。传统H5开发面临三大核心痛点:技术门槛高、制作周期长、跨设备适配复杂。H5-Dooring通过低代码可视化编辑模式,重新定义了H5制作的价值标准。

低门槛与专业级效果的平衡之道

如何让非技术人员也能制作出专业水准的H5页面?H5-Dooring采用"所见即所得"的编辑模式,将复杂的代码逻辑封装在直观的交互界面之下。用户只需通过拖拽组件、配置属性即可完成页面制作,同时保持输出代码的规范性和可维护性。这种平衡设计使设计师、运营人员和开发人员能够协同工作,各自发挥专长。

H5-Dooring项目管理首页

效率提升的量化分析

制作环节 传统开发方式 H5-Dooring方式 效率提升
页面布局 手动编写HTML/CSS (2-4小时) 拖拽组件自动生成 (15-30分钟) 80-90%
交互实现 JavaScript编程 (1-3小时) 配置化交互设置 (5-15分钟) 90%
多端适配 媒体查询与测试 (1-2小时) 自动响应式布局 (实时预览) 95%
部署上线 服务器配置与上传 (30-60分钟) 一键打包与部署 (5分钟) 85%

全流程覆盖的闭环设计

H5-Dooring不仅解决单一制作环节的问题,更提供从创意到上线的全流程支持。通过模板库、组件市场、预览测试和部署工具的有机整合,形成完整的H5制作生态系统。这种闭环设计消除了工具切换带来的效率损耗,使制作流程更加顺畅。

核心能力:H5-Dooring如何解决实际制作难题?

理解H5-Dooring的核心能力,需要从其技术架构和功能实现两个层面展开。这款工具如何将复杂的技术实现转化为用户友好的操作体验?其动态渲染引擎和组件化体系是关键所在。

动态渲染引擎:实现灵活高效的页面生成

什么是动态渲染引擎,它如何提升H5页面的制作效率?H5-Dooring的核心是DynamicEngine.tsx动态渲染引擎,该引擎能够实时解析用户配置的JSON结构,动态加载所需组件,并高效渲染到页面。这种设计带来三大优势:一是页面加载性能优化,仅加载当前所需组件;二是支持组件热更新,修改配置无需刷新页面;三是实现内存高效管理,避免常见的内存泄漏问题。

组件化体系:标准化与扩展性的统一

H5-Dooring如何保证组件的一致性和扩展性?系统采用严格的组件接口规范,所有组件遵循统一的数据结构和生命周期管理。基础组件接口包含唯一标识(id)、组件类型(type)和配置项(config)三个核心要素。这种标准化设计确保了组件之间的兼容性,同时为自定义组件开发提供了清晰的扩展路径。用户可以根据业务需求,开发符合规范的新组件并集成到系统中。

H5-Dooring部署流程图

数据驱动架构:实现内容与形式的分离

数据驱动架构如何提升H5页面的可维护性?H5-Dooring将所有页面配置以JSON格式存储,实现了内容数据与呈现形式的分离。这种设计带来多重好处:配置可导出备份,便于版本管理;支持团队协作编辑,多人可同时修改不同模块;能够与后端系统无缝对接,实现动态内容更新。数据驱动还为AI辅助设计奠定了基础,未来可通过分析配置数据提供智能设计建议。

实战路径:如何使用H5-Dooring完成专业H5制作?

掌握H5-Dooring的使用方法,需要遵循从环境搭建到发布上线的完整流程。以下实战路径将帮助你快速上手并制作出专业级H5页面。

环境搭建与项目初始化

如何快速搭建H5-Dooring开发环境?首先需要准备Node.js(14.0+版本)和npm包管理工具。通过以下步骤即可完成环境搭建:

  1. 克隆项目代码库:git clone https://gitcode.com/gh_mirrors/h5/h5-Dooring
  2. 进入项目目录:cd h5-Dooring
  3. 安装依赖包:npm install
  4. 启动开发服务:npm start
  5. 在浏览器访问:http://localhost:3000

系统会自动打开H5-Dooring的管理界面,此时你已准备好开始H5页面制作。

场景化任务指南:制作营销活动页面

如何在30分钟内完成一个促销活动H5页面?以电商平台的限时折扣活动为例,遵循以下步骤:

  1. 模板选择:在项目管理界面点击"新建页面",从营销活动分类中选择"限时折扣模板"
  2. 内容替换
    • 点击页面中的图片组件,上传产品图片
    • 修改标题文本为活动主题"618限时特惠"
    • 更新价格标签和折扣信息
  3. 交互配置
    • 为"立即购买"按钮添加跳转链接
    • 设置倒计时组件,配置活动结束时间
    • 添加表单组件收集用户信息
  4. 预览测试:切换不同设备视图(手机、平板、PC)检查响应式效果
  5. 发布上线:点击"导出"按钮选择"一键部署",生成可访问的H5页面链接

通过这种模板化+个性化的制作方式,非技术人员也能快速完成专业级H5页面。

高级技巧:自定义组件开发

有开发经验的用户如何扩展H5-Dooring的功能?系统支持自定义组件开发,只需遵循以下规范:

  1. src/materials目录下创建组件文件夹
  2. 实现组件渲染逻辑(React组件)
  3. 定义组件配置Schema(控制属性面板)
  4. 设置组件模板数据(默认配置)
  5. 注册组件到组件库

开发完成的自定义组件将自动出现在左侧组件面板中,与系统内置组件具有相同的使用体验。

场景拓展:H5-Dooring在不同领域的创新应用

H5-Dooring的灵活性使其能够适应多种应用场景,从简单的宣传页面到复杂的数据可视化,都能通过同一工具高效实现。

企业展示与品牌宣传

如何利用H5-Dooring打造专业的企业展示页面?系统提供了丰富的企业组件,包括公司介绍、产品展示、团队介绍、联系方式等模块。用户可以通过组合这些组件,快速构建具有品牌特色的企业微网站。特别适合初创公司和中小企业,在预算有限的情况下快速建立线上 presence。

数据可视化大屏

H5-Dooring如何支持数据可视化需求?系统的可视化组件库包含多种图表类型(折线图、柱状图、饼图等),支持静态数据配置和API接口对接。通过这些组件,用户可以制作实时数据监控大屏,适用于运营监控、销售分析、会议展示等场景。数据大屏支持全屏展示,并针对不同分辨率进行了优化。

H5-Dooring多端预览效果

教育与培训内容制作

教育机构如何利用H5-Dooring制作互动学习内容?系统的表单组件、多媒体支持和交互功能,使其成为制作互动课件的理想工具。教师可以创建包含视频讲解、测验、互动练习的学习页面,学生通过手机即可参与学习并提交答案。这种互动式学习内容能够显著提升学习效果和参与度。

常见问题解答

H5-Dooring生成的页面性能如何?

系统采用组件懒加载和代码分割技术,确保页面加载速度。生成的代码经过优化,最小化资源体积。对于包含大量图片的页面,建议使用图片压缩功能和CDN加速。

如何与团队成员协作开发?

H5-Dooring支持项目导出和导入功能,团队成员可以通过分享JSON配置文件进行协作。高级版本还提供云端协作功能,支持多人同时编辑和版本控制。

能否对接企业现有的后端系统?

是的,系统支持通过API接口获取动态数据。用户可以在组件配置中设置数据源URL,系统会自动获取并展示数据。同时支持自定义数据处理函数,满足复杂的数据展示需求。

生成的H5页面是否支持SEO优化?

系统支持设置页面标题、描述和关键词等SEO元数据。对于需要深度SEO的场景,可以导出HTML代码后进行进一步优化。

H5-Dooring通过创新的低代码可视化编辑方式,正在改变H5页面的制作方式。无论是个人创作者、企业营销团队还是开发人员,都能从中获得效率提升和创作自由。通过本文介绍的价值定位、核心能力、实战路径和场景拓展,你已经具备了使用H5-Dooring制作专业H5页面的基础知识。现在就开始探索这款强大工具的更多可能性,将创意快速转化为令人印象深刻的H5页面。

登录后查看全文
热门项目推荐
相关项目推荐